2022-03-31Remove `MatcherPos::stack`.Nicholas Nethercote-62/+74
`parse_tt` needs a way to get from within submatchers make to the enclosing submatchers. Currently it has two distinct mechanisms for this: - `Delimited` submatchers use `MatcherPos::stack` to record stuff about the parent (and further back ancestors). - `Sequence` submatchers use `MatcherPosSequence::parent` to point to the parent matcher position. Having two mechanisms is really confusing, and it took me a long time to understand all this. This commit eliminates `MatcherPos::stack`, and changes `Delimited` submatchers to use the same mechanism as sequence submatchers. That mechanism is also changed a bit: instead of storing the entire parent `MatcherPos`, we now only store the necessary parts from the parent `MatcherPos`. Overall this is a small performance win, with the positives outweighing the negatives, but it's mostly for clarity.

2022-03-30Overhaul how matches are recorded.Nicholas Nethercote-48/+55
Currently, matches within a sequence are recorded in a new empty `matches` vector. Then when the sequence finishes the matches are merged into the `matches` vector of the parent. This commit changes things so that a sequence mp inherits the matches made so far. This means that additional matches from the sequence don't need to be merged into the parent. `push_match` becomes more complicated, and the current sequence depth needs to be tracked. But it's a sizeable performance win because it avoids one or more `push_match` calls on every iteration of a sequence. The commit also removes `match_hi`, which is no longer necessary.

2022-03-25Split `NamedMatch::MatchNonterminal` in two.Nicholas Nethercote-71/+81
The `Lrc` is only relevant within `transcribe()`. There, the `Lrc` is helpful for the non-`NtTT` cases, because the entire nonterminal is cloned. But for the `NtTT` cases the inner token tree is cloned (a full clone) and so the `Lrc` is of no help. This commit splits the `NtTT` and non-`NtTT` cases, avoiding the useless `Lrc` in the former case, for the following effect on macro-heavy crates. - It reduces the total number of allocations a lot. - It increases the size of some of the remaining allocations. - It doesn't affect *peak* memory usage, because the larger allocations are short-lived. This overall gives a speed win.

2022-03-23Eliminate `TokenTreeOrTokenTreeSlice`.Nicholas Nethercote-173/+146
As its name suggests, `TokenTreeOrTokenTreeSlice` is either a single `TokenTree` or a slice of them. It has methods `len` and `get_tt` that let it be treated much like an ordinary slice. The reason it isn't an ordinary slice is that for `TokenTree::Delimited` the open and close delimiters are represented implicitly, and when they are needed they are constructed on the fly with `Delimited::{open,close}_tt`, rather than being present in memory. This commit changes `Delimited` so the open and close delimiters are represented explicitly. As a result, `TokenTreeOrTokenTreeSlice` is no longer needed and `MatcherPos` and `MatcherTtFrame` can just use an ordinary slice. `TokenTree::{len,get_tt}` are also removed, because they were only needed to support `TokenTreeOrTokenTreeSlice`. The change makes the code shorter and a little bit faster on benchmarks that use macro expansion heavily, partly because `MatcherPos` is a lot smaller (less data to `memcpy`) and partly because ordinary slice operations are faster than `TokenTreeOrTokenTreeSlice::{len,get_tt}`.

2022-03-21Remove `MatcherPosHandle`.Nicholas Nethercote-88/+23
This type was a small performance win for `html5ever`, which uses a macro with hundreds of very simple rules that don't contain any metavariables. But this type is complicated (extra lifetimes) and perf-neutral for macros that do have metavariables. This commit removes `MatcherPosHandle`, simplifying things a lot. This increases the allocation rate for `html5ever` and similar cases a bit, but makes things easier for follow-up changes that will improve performance more than what we lost here.
